Three Card Poker

A popular casino card game, 3 Card Poker offers a range of betting options and some big pay offs for certain hands. Each game is played with one 52 card deck of cards with three cards dealt to the player and three dealt to the dealer. The aim of the game is to get the best possible hand.

Hand rankings in three card poker are slightly different from those in normal poker as a straight is higher than a flush. This is due to the fact that it is harder to make a three card straight as opposed to a flush. As there are only three cards in play the highest hands are straight flush followed by 3 of a kind.

There are two betting options when playing three card poker, the Ante / Raise bet and the Pair Plus bet. You can choose to play both or either of the two. First we will look at the Ante / Raise bet.

The Ante / Raise bet is a game of beating the dealers hand. You place a wager on the ante section of the table and then receive three cards. You then have to decide if you think your hand is good enough to beat the dealers hand which you cannot see. In general you should bet with any hand of Q,6,4 or better. This is because the dealer must have Queen high to qualify.

Once you have decided to bet the dealers cards are revealed. Here there are a couple of outcomes. If the dealer has a better hand than yours you lose. If the dealer does not qualify then you get 1 to 1 on your ante and your bet is returned. If the dealer qualifies and your hand is better you get 1 to 1 on both your ante and your raise bets.

There are also additional ante bonuses for some hands, these are :

  • Straight (1 to 1)
  • Three of a Kind (4 to 1)
  • Straight Flush (5 to 1)

The second betting option is the Pair Plus bet. Here you are betting that your three cards will contain a pair or higher. This is a one play bet as you either win or lose on the initial deal and have no further choices to make. Pay offs for the Pair Plus bets can be big if you hit the right cards. These are :

  • Any Pair (1 to 1
  • Flush (4 to 1)
  • Three of a kind (30 to 1)
  • Straight (6 to 1)
  • Straight Flush (40 to 1)

These pay offs can vary from casino to casino but are generally the same. The house edge for three card poker ranges from around 3% on the ante bet and just over 2% on the pair plus bet.
